SCU Nixon (SOF) 2.21 TRANSCRIPT: NIXON: SEQ 2: "I realize that those who are protesting believe that this decision will expand the war, increase American casualties, and increase American involvement. And those who protest want peace, they want to reduce American casualties, and they want our boys brought home. I made a decision, however, for the very reasons that they are protesting, and as far as affecting my decision is concerned, their protests I'm concerned about. I'm concerned because I know how deeply they feel. But I know, that what I have done will accomplish the goals that they want. It will shorten this war, it will reduce American casualties, it will allow us to go forward with our withdrawal programme. The one hundred and fifty thousand Americans that I announced for withdrawal in the next year will come home on schedule and it will, in my opinion, serve the cause of a just peace in Vietnam I would add this, I think I understand what I want. i would hope that they would understand somewhat what I want. When I came to the Presidency I did not send these man to Vietnam there were 525,000 men there. Since I've been there I've been working 18 to 20 hours a day, mostly on Vietnam, trying to bring these men home. We've brought home a hundred and fifteen thousand. Our casualties were the lowest in the first quarter of this year. We're going to bring home another one hundred and fifty thousand. And as a result of the greater accomplishments than we expected even in the first week of the Cambodian campaign I believe that we will have accomplished our goal reducing American casualties and also of hastening the day that we can have a just peace. But above everything else to continue the withdrawal programme that they're for and I'm for." Initials SAW/N-TELE/PW/SGM Script is copyright Reuters Limited. All rights reserved
